How is the Relative Performance Index in Streets derived

Post by azelaya » Tue Sep 20, 2011 12:20 pm

The Relative Performance Index in Streets allows a user to assess how a tree species is performing relative to all tree species in a community. It is based on the proportion of each individual species classified as "good" condition class divided by the total population of trees classified as good. In essence, it allows you to determine if a tree species is performing better or worse than the overall population based on either a below or above average condition rating.
